    Title: 中共和平發展下的中美關係
    Other Titles: Sino-U.S. relations under P.R.C's peaceful development policy
    Authors: 顏志榮;Yen, Chih-Rong
    Contributors: 淡江大學國際事務與戰略研究所碩士在職專班
    王高成
    Keywords: 中國崛起;和平崛起;中美關係;台灣問題;美台軍售;China Rise;China's Peaceful rise;China's peaceful development;Sino-U.S. Relations;Taiwan Issue;U.S. Arms sales to Taiwan
    Date: 2011
    Issue Date: 2011-12-28 17:05:45 (UTC+8)
    Abstract: 冷戰結束後,美國發展為當今世界唯一的「超級大國」,在「一超多強」的國際格局下,美國在政治、經濟、軍事和文化各方面的實力遠遠超過其他大國。尤其是在全球化時代,國內政治國際化、國際政治國內化的趨勢日益明顯,任何一國內部的政治和經濟都和世界政治與經濟緊密相連。因此,無論是中共的政經發展、社會變化,抑或是安全、外交、貿易和兩岸統一的問題等,美國都深涉其中,成為影響「中國崛起」的最大外部因素。
    本研究即著眼於大陸「中國改革開放論壇」理事長鄭必堅於2003 年4 月在「博鼇論壇」發表「中國和平崛起與亞洲的未來」演講,首次提出「和平崛起」概念,藉此反擊「中國威脅論」,有關「中國崛起」的討論進入一個新的階段,對「中」美關係亦漸次產生影響。惟近年中共官方已較少使用「和平崛起」,轉而使用「和平發展」,主張透過和平而非戰爭的方式來實現「和平發展」,其面對的重大課題是如何讓大國、周邊國家接受自己,從而創造一個有利於國內改革和發展的國際環境。
    研究探討的結果顯示,中共不滿美國推行單極的全球戰略,將防止出現可能挑戰其「一超」地位的國家,作為全球戰略核心目標,所以將正在崛起的中共視為威脅「一超」地位的主要障礙和潛在對手,而在臺灣問題方面,中共認為臺灣是美國遏制大陸在亞洲擴張的重要籌碼,對臺軍售是美國涉入臺灣問題的主要手段,臺灣問題仍將是影響「中」美關係的不確定因素。
    在未來一段時間內,國際戰略格局不變,「中」美關係不會有重大突破,美國的對「中」政策也不會進行大幅調整,臺灣在美國全球戰略格局中的地位沒有改變,仍具有重要的「制中」作用。但是當前美國自身深陷伊拉克、阿富汗等反恐問題泥沼,「中」美軍事交流也逐漸恢復正常,近期應不致於高調地處理對臺軍售問題,引起雙邊關係的嚴重倒退。建議我政府宜持續爭取美方支持,化解其對臺軍售疑慮,俾在兩岸談判中居於主動地位。
